import { compareObjects } from "../source/Compare.js";
import Main from "./Main.js";
const {
createRecord,
compare,
update,
Record,
navigate,
insertStyles,
normalizeEvent,
Just,
Nothing,
at,
array,
style,
} = Main;
beforeEach(() => {
console.warn = jest.fn();
});
afterEach(() => {
jest.resetAllMocks();
});
describe("compareObjects", () => {
test("compares null and undefined with ===", () => {
expect(compareObjects(undefined, undefined)).toBe(true);
expect(console.warn.mock.calls.length).toBe(1);
});
test("returns false for not equal objects", () => {
expect(compareObjects({ a: "A" }, { a: "B" })).toBe(false);
});
});
describe("compare", () => {
test("compares null and undefined with ===", () => {
expect(compare(undefined, undefined)).toBe(true);
expect(compare(null, undefined)).toBe(false);
expect(compare(undefined, null)).toBe(false);
expect(compare(null, null)).toBe(true);
expect(console.warn.mock.calls.length).toBe(2);
});
test("compares with the value that is not null", () => {
expect(compare(null, "A")).toBe(false);
});
});
describe("update", () => {
test("creates a new version of the given record with new data", () => {
let oldRecord = new Record({ name: "John" });
let newRecord = update(oldRecord, new Record({ name: "Doe" }));
expect(compare(newRecord, oldRecord)).toBe(false);
expect(newRecord.name).toBe("Doe");
});
test("it keeps the constructor", () => {
let TestRecord = createRecord({});
let testRecord = new TestRecord({});
let newRecord = update(testRecord, new Record({ name: "Doe" }));
expect(newRecord).toBeInstanceOf(TestRecord);
expect(newRecord.name).toBe("Doe");
});
test("it creates a record if object is passed", () => {
let newRecord = update({}, { name: "Doe" });
expect(newRecord).toBeInstanceOf(Record);
expect(newRecord.name).toBe("Doe");
});
});
describe("navigate", () => {
beforeEach(() => {
window.dispatchEvent = jest.fn();
window.window.scrollTo = jest.fn();
});
test("`Window.setUrl()` does not dispatch and does not jump", () => {
navigate("/foo", /* dispatch */ false);
expect(window.location.pathname).toBe("/foo");
expect(window.dispatchEvent.mock.calls.length).toBe(0);
expect(window.scrollTo.mock.calls.length).toBe(0);
});
test("`Window.navigate()` sets the url and dispatches and does not jump", () => {
navigate("/bar", /* dispatch */ true, /* triggerJump */ false);
expect(window.location.pathname).toBe("/bar");
expect(window.dispatchEvent.mock.calls.length).toBe(1);
expect(window.scrollTo.mock.calls.length).toBe(0);
});
test("`Window.jump()` sets the url and dispatches and jumps if it has a defined route", () => {
navigate("/baz", /* dispatch */ true, /* triggerJump */ true);
expect(window.location.pathname).toBe("/baz");
expect(window.dispatchEvent.mock.calls.length).toBe(1);
// Scrolling only happens when the url matches a defined route. This is
// currently not tested.
});
});
describe("insertStyles", () => {
test("adds styles to the document", () => {
insertStyles("test");
expect(document.head.querySelector("style").textContent).toBe("test");
});
});
describe("array", () => {
test("it an array for not arrays", () => {
expect(array(0)).toEqual([0]);
});
test("doesn't do anything for an array", () => {
expect(array([0])).toEqual([0]);
});
});
describe("style", () => {
test("it creates an object from objects and maps", () => {
expect(
style([
"opacity:0; z-index: 100 ; ",
new Map([["a", "b"]]),
new Map([[101, "d"]]),
[["x", "y"]],
{ c: "d" },
{ z: 123 },
])
).toEqual({
"z-index": "100",
opacity: "0",
a: "b",
101: "d",
x: "y",
c: "d",
z: "123",
});
});
});
describe("at", () => {
test("it returns a just for an element", () => {
let result = at([0], 0);
expect(result).toBeInstanceOf(Just);
expect(result._0).toBe(0);
});
test("it returns nothing for an element", () => {
let result = at([0], 1);
expect(result).toBeInstanceOf(Nothing);
});
test("it returns nothing if index is negative", () => {
let result = at([0], -1);
expect(result).toBeInstanceOf(Nothing);
});
});
describe("normalizeEvent", () => {
test("returns default values if they are not defined", () => {
const event = normalizeEvent({ test: "X", preventDefault: () => "P" });
expect(event.dataTransfer).not.toBe(undefined);
expect(event.dataTransfer.setData("test", "test")).toBe(null);
expect(event.dataTransfer.getData("not present")).toBe("");
expect(event.dataTransfer.getData("test")).toBe("test");
expect(event.dataTransfer.clearData()).toBe(null);
expect(event.clipboardData).not.toBe(undefined);
expect(event.preventDefault()).toBe("P");
expect(event.data).toBe("");
expect(event.altKey).toBe(false);
expect(event.charCode).toBe(-1);
expect(event.ctrlKey).toBe(false);
expect(event.key).toBe("");
expect(event.keyCode).toBe(-1);
expect(event.locale).toBe("");
expect(event.location).toBe(-1);
expect(event.metaKey).toBe(false);
expect(event.repeat).toBe(false);
expect(event.shiftKey).toBe(false);
expect(event.which).toBe(-1);
expect(event.button).toBe(-1);
expect(event.buttons).toBe(-1);
expect(event.clientX).toBe(-1);
expect(event.clientY).toBe(-1);
expect(event.pageX).toBe(-1);
expect(event.pageY).toBe(-1);
expect(event.screenY).toBe(-1);
expect(event.screenX).toBe(-1);
expect(event.detail).toBe(-1);
expect(event.deltaMode).toBe(-1);
expect(event.deltaX).toBe(-1);
expect(event.deltaY).toBe(-1);
expect(event.deltaZ).toBe(-1);
expect(event.animationName).toBe("");
expect(event.pseudoElement).toBe("");
expect(event.elapsedTime).toBe(-1);
expect(event.propertyName).toBe("");
expect(event.blah).toBe(undefined);
expect(event.test).toBe("X");
});
});
